Summary
Support internal leadership and customer sales teams in providing comprehensive account analysis and reporting. Key focus on analytics to include customer profitability measures, key customer shipment and consumption activity. Update reports to track team progress to goals and create/build new reports as needed to keep up with the evolving needs of the business. Complete ad hoc requests as needed by the Sales Team. Provide internal and external sales management with the tools and real-time analytical capabilities to support sales strategies, execution and measurements. Capitalize on process synergies and automation by partnering with internal departments and developing standardized, efficient and repeatable processes.
Responsibilities
* Serve as primary point of contact for key strategic customer teams. * Manage, track, and project shipments and consumption of Abbott products to support monthly forecast process. * Manage, track and report promotional performance and ROI. * Authority to correct/adjust data and alignments to preserve and protect integrity of reporting. * Accountability of maintenance to provide accurate reporting that will drive business decisions for Sales and Marketing. * Influence and work with those outside of sales analysis to ensure accuracy of data. * Develop and communicate sales analysis and data insights. * Responsible for implementing and maintaining the effectiveness and quality of available data and analysis. * Identify and respond to opportunities to automate processes and streamline efficiencies. * Understand the goals and objectives of the Division and Sales Force.
Ideal Candidate
* Strong analytical ability and interest. * Experience and advanced knowledge of Excel. * Familiar with 3rd party reporting tools and data integration - Nielsen, IRI, RSi/SOLYS * Interest to advance into sales, marketing and/or category management roles. * 2-3 years’ experience in Sales, Finance, IT, * Preferred previous experience working with retail customers in grocery/club/mass.
